Chinese trade data beats expectations in April to show signs of stabilisation as demand improves both home and abroad. British chip designer ARM sees shares tumble almost 9 per cent in after-hours trade following gloomy revenue guidance which has fueled concerns of a slowdown in A.I. demand. President Joe Biden warns Israel the U.S. will pause weapons deliveries if the IDF invades Rafah. Markets are split ahead of the BoE rate decision later today over a potential rate cut forecast for June.
